1. Introduction: What is Molecular Degeneration?

 

Molecular degeneration (commonly referred to as macular degeneration) is a chronic eye condition that primarily affects older adults. It occurs when the macula—the small central part of the retina—deteriorates, leading to vision loss in the center of the field of view. Macular degeneration is the leading cause of vision impairment in people over 60 and can drastically affect everyday activities such as reading, driving, and recognizing faces.

 

As our population ages, understanding macular degeneration, its symptoms, causes, and treatment options is essential for maintaining eye health and overall quality of life. While there is no complete cure, early detection and lifestyle changes can slow its progression.

 

        

 

2. Types of Macular Degeneration

 

There are two primary forms of macular degeneration: dry (atrophic) and wet (neovascular).

 

  • Dry Macular Degeneration: This is the more common form, accounting for about 80-90% of cases. It occurs when the light-sensitive cells in the macula break down over time, leading to a gradual loss of central vision. Early signs include blurry vision or difficulty recognizing faces.
  • Wet Macular Degeneration: Though less common, this form is more severe and progresses quickly. It happens when abnormal blood vessels grow under the retina and leak fluid or blood, causing the macula to bulge, distorting vision.

 

        

 

3. What Causes Macular Degeneration?

 

Several factors contribute to the development of macular degeneration. While age is the most significant risk factor, genetics and lifestyle choices play a role.

 

  • Smoking: Smokers are more than twice as likely to develop macular degeneration compared to non-smokers. Smoking reduces blood flow to the retina and damages sensitive eye tissue.
  • Diet and Nutrition: Diets high in unhealthy fats and low in antioxidants have been associated with a higher risk of macular degeneration.
  • Sunlight Exposure: Long-term exposure to ultraviolet (UV) light without proper eye protection may increase the risk.

 

4. Symptoms of Macular Degeneration

 

Common symptoms include:

 

  • Blurred Vision: Difficulty seeing fine details, even when wearing glasses or contacts, is often one of the first signs of macular degeneration.
  • Dark or Blind Spots: As the condition progresses, individuals may develop blind spots in the center of their vision.
  • Distorted Vision: Straight lines may appear wavy or distorted due to fluid buildup.
  • Fading Colors: Colors may appear less vibrant, contributing to a dull appearance of the world around them.

6. Treatment Options for Macular Degeneration

 

Though there’s no cure, treatments can slow progression. Treatment depends on whether the condition is dry or wet macular degeneration.

 

For Dry Macular Degeneration:

  • AREDS Supplements: These contain a specific combination of vitamins C and E, zinc, copper, lutein, and zeaxanthin, which help reduce the risk of advanced macular degeneration.
